Output 807c871483dc1cef0cdddcdaeaebc11c00234d0d62bce1f590a6059dfd8a68f7:0

value
486080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a7d3dcbee485d6cb28a2c5414d535de7a19c96e OP_EQUAL
address
3475XTPrBW2qAfpKaK7XQTeHmqoMbKoEgE
transaction
807c871483dc1cef0cdddcdaeaebc11c00234d0d62bce1f590a6059dfd8a68f7
confirmations
119028
spent
true